165,862 (one hundred sixty-five thousand eight hundred sixty-two) is an even 6-digit number. It is a composite number with 8 divisors, and factors as 2 × 127 × 653. Written other ways, in hexadecimal, 0x287E6.

Goldbach decomposition

Goldbach's conjecture says every even integer greater than 2 is the sum of two primes. For 165862, here are decompositions:

  • 5 + 165857 = 165862
  • 29 + 165833 = 165862
  • 83 + 165779 = 165862
  • 113 + 165749 = 165862
  • 149 + 165713 = 165862
  • 251 + 165611 = 165862
  • 293 + 165569 = 165862
  • 311 + 165551 = 165862

Showing the first eight; more decompositions exist.
